Factorial Energy (FAC) CFO reports shares and stock options in Form 3
Rhea-AI Filing Summary
Factorial Energy Inc. Chief Financial Officer Wei Richard filed a Form 3 reporting his existing equity stake in the company. He holds 550,488 shares of Series A Common Stock directly. He also holds stock options over 293,472 shares at an exercise price of $2.64 per share, expiring on October 7, 2035, and options over 73,368 shares at an exercise price of $0.08 per share, expiring on September 5, 2029. One option grant is fully vested and exercisable, while the other vests in ten equal monthly installments after September 24, 2025, contingent on his continued service.

Form 3 is the initial public filing that officers, directors and large shareholders must submit to report their ownership of a company’s securities when they become insiders. It acts like an opening inventory sheet that gives investors a starting point to see who holds significant stakes and to spot later trades or potential conflicts of interest, helping assess insider confidence and transparency.

Does the Form 3 for Factorial Energy (FAC) report any insider buying or selling?
The Form 3 records holdings, not new trades. It lists Wei Richard’s existing shares and options but shows no open-market buy or sell transactions. Form 3 filings typically provide a baseline of insider ownership when someone becomes a reporting person.
